Welcome C. August to the Rule of Reason

I'd like extend a hearty welcome to C. August as a new contributor to the Rule of Reason. You may recognize him from his blog, Titanic Deck Chairs. C. lives in the suburbs of Boston and works as web development manager. Prior to going over to the dark side of IT back when the Internet was new, he worked as a scientist at a medical technology company. He has been an Objectivist since his college days in the early 90s, and he tells me that his intellectual interests include history, economics, biology, and helping his two young children develop into happy, rational people.

He says that his main goal in joining the Rule of Reason is to lend his voice in the defense of individual rights and capitalism, from what he sees as their primary ideological enemies; Islamism, Christian fundamentalism, environmentalism, and the crippling pragmatism endemic in modern American politics.

In that light, I could not be happier to have him join the ranks.
